enteroaggregative e. coli is able to stick to the mucosal lining of the intestines. this is most likely due to the presence of a ____________ virulence factor.

Answers

The most likely virulence factor responsible for the ability of enteroaggregative E. coli to stick to the mucosal lining of the intestines is a fimbriae called aggregative adherence fimbriae (AAF).

Enteroaggregative E. coli (EAEC) is known for its characteristic aggregative adherence pattern, where it forms stacked or "stacked-brick" adherence to the intestinal mucosa. This pattern allows the bacteria to adhere to the epithelial cells of the intestines and establish infection.

Aggregative adherence fimbriae (AAF) are appendages on the surface of EAEC that play a crucial role in mediating the aggregation and adherence of the bacteria to the intestinal mucosa. These fimbriae are involved in the initial attachment of EAEC to host cells and the formation of biofilms, contributing to the colonization and persistence of the bacteria within the intestines.

Shortly after ingesting a big plate of carbohydrate-rich pasta, you measure your blood's hormone levels. What results would you expect, compared to before the meal

After ingesting a plate of pasta, which is rich in carbohydrates, the levels of insulin increases and glucagon decreases in the blood.

The working of insulin and glucagon:

The hormone insulin and glucagon work in a negative feedback loop. At the time of digestion, the foods, which comprise carbohydrates are transformed into glucose. The majority of this glucose is sent to the bloodstream, resulting the elevation of blood glucose levels.

This enhancement in the levels of glucose in the blood signals the pancreas to generate insulin, and reduce the levels of glucagon in the blood. After some hours, glucagon works to counterbalance the activities of insulin.

After five to six hours, the levels of glucose in the blood decreases due to the activity of insulin, this instigates the pancreas to generate glucagon.

Thus, after eating carbohydrate rich food, the levels of insulin increases in the blood and glucagon decreases.

what are the four stages of the inbound methodology?

Answers

The four stages of the inbound methodology are Attract, Convert, Close and Delight.

1. Attract: The first stage of inbound marketing is attracting visitors to your site. It's all about creating great content and optimizing it for search engines. Social media marketing and other forms of online advertising may also be used to attract visitors to your site.

2. Convert: This is the process of turning visitors into leads. This is accomplished by offering valuable content to your visitors in exchange for their contact information. Landing pages, calls-to-action, and forms are all effective tools for converting visitors into leads.

3. Close: Once you've captured the contact information of a lead, it's time to move on to the next stage: closing. This involves nurturing the lead and providing them with valuable information to help them make a purchasing decision. Email marketing, lead scoring, and customer relationship management tools are all useful in this stage.

4. Delight: The final stage of the inbound methodology is to delight your customers. This involves providing excellent customer service and support, as well as continuing to provide valuable content and information to keep your customers engaged and happy. Social media, surveys, and customer feedback tools can all be used to delight customers and keep them coming back for more.

Keystone species: Group of answer choices are more expendable than commensal species, from a conservation perspective. occur only in intertidal zones. are primary producers and therefore usually are plants. can be removed from a habitat without any impact on the remaining species in the habitat. play an unusually important role in determining the species composition in a habitat.

Answers

The correct choice is:
play an unusually important role in determining the species composition in a habitat.

A keystone species is one that has a disproportionately large effect on the ecosystem relative to its size or abundance. Some key characteristics of keystone species:

• They are not necessarily abundant or dominate the ecosystem numerically or in terms of biomass. But they have an outsized influence on the environment and other species.

• They help maintain the structure, composition, and functioning of the ecological community. Their impact is much greater than would be expected based on their abundance.

• The ecosystem would change drastically if the keystone species were removed. Many other species depend on them to survive, and the whole food web could shift.

• They facilitate the coexistence of other species by reducing competition for resources. For example, sea otters control sea urchin populations which in turn determine the health of kelp forests.

• They are not necessarily primary producers (plants) or restricted to intertidal zones. They can be at any trophic level (producer, primary, secondary, tertiary consumer). Their impact depends on ecological role, not diet or habitat.

• They cannot be removed without major disruptions. The remaining species depend heavily on the keystone species to regulate the ecosystem. Their impact far outweighs their numbers.

The other choices do not accurately describe keystone species:

• Are more expendable: Keystone species fill an essential role and are not expendable. They would greatly impact the ecosystem if removed.

• Occur only in intertidal zones: Keystone species can occur in any ecosystem, not just intertidal zones. Sea otters are an example commonly cited but they are not restricted to intertidal areas.

• Are primary producers: While some keystone species are plants, many others are carnivores, detritivores or other types of consumers. Their role depends on function, not trophic level.

• Can be removed without impact: No, keystone species by definition provide an essential regulating function. Removing them would drastically disrupt the ecosystem.

In summary, the key characteristic of a keystone species is that it has a disproportionately large effect on the ecosystem relative to its abundance. Keystone species help maintain community structure and composition, facilitate coexistence, and fill a crucial regulatory niche. Their impact is essential but extends beyond what would be expected based on their numbers.

does a longer extension time during PCR affect its overall
amplification?

Answers

Yes, the extension time during PCR can affect its overall amplification. The extension time is the step in PCR where the DNA polymerase extends the primers and synthesizes new DNA strands.

A longer extension time allows the DNA polymerase more time to complete the synthesis of the DNA strands, resulting in longer amplification products. Conversely, a shorter extension time may result in incomplete synthesis and shorter amplification products.

The optimal extension time for PCR depends on the length of the target DNA and the efficiency of the DNA polymerase used. It is typically determined based on the desired amplicon size and the specific requirements of the experiment. Too short of an extension time may result in low yield or incomplete amplification, while excessively long extension times may increase the risk of nonspecific amplification or generate unwanted side products.

Strains of pigeons bred for superior homing ability have larger _______ than other Pigeons.
A) mammillary bodies
B) testes
C) optic tecta
D) hippocampi

Answers

D) Hippocampi. Strains of pigeons bred for superior homing ability have been found to have larger hippocampi than other pigeons.

The hippocampus is a part of the brain that is important for spatial learning and memory, which is crucial for the ability to navigate and find their way home over long distances. This suggests that the larger hippocampi in these strains of pigeons may play a role in their enhanced homing ability. The ability to navigate and find their way home is an important survival skill for pigeons, and the ability to breed for this trait has been utilized by humans for thousands of years. Understanding the neurological basis for homing ability in pigeons may also have implications for studying spatial learning and memory in other animals, including humans.
